    Factors Affecting the KTM RC 390 Price in Saudi Arabia

    Alright, let's get down to business. Several factors can influence the KTM RC 390 price in Saudi Arabia. Here’s a breakdown:

    • Base Price: The manufacturer's suggested retail price (MSRP) is the starting point. This is the price KTM sets before any additional costs are added.
    • Taxes and Duties: Saudi Arabia imposes taxes and import duties on vehicles, which significantly impact the final price. These fees can vary, so it's essential to get the latest information from authorized dealers.
    • Dealer Margins: Dealers add their profit margins, which can differ from one dealership to another. Don't be afraid to shop around and negotiate!
    • Optional Features and Accessories: If you want to customize your RC 390 with extras like performance parts, cosmetic upgrades, or protective gear, these will add to the overall cost.
    • Currency Exchange Rates: Fluctuations in currency exchange rates between the Saudi Riyal and other currencies (like the Euro, where KTM is manufactured) can affect the price.
    • Registration and Insurance: Don't forget about the costs associated with registering your bike and obtaining insurance. These are mandatory expenses that you need to factor into your budget.

    Understanding these factors will help you get a clearer picture of what you can expect to pay for your KTM RC 390.

    Current Market Price of KTM RC 390 in Saudi Arabia

    As of my last update, the KTM RC 390 price in Saudi Arabia typically ranges from SAR 22,000 to SAR 28,000. However, this is an estimated range. Prices can vary based on the factors I mentioned earlier. For the most accurate and up-to-date pricing, I highly recommend contacting authorized KTM dealers in Saudi Arabia. They can provide you with detailed quotes, including all applicable taxes and fees. Keep in mind that special promotions or discounts may be available, so it's always worth asking about any ongoing deals. Additionally, if you're considering purchasing a used RC 390, prices can be significantly lower, but it's crucial to thoroughly inspect the bike's condition and maintenance history before making a decision.     Ownership Costs to Consider

    Besides the initial purchase price, remember to factor in the ongoing costs of owning a KTM RC 390:

    • Insurance: Motorcycle insurance is mandatory in Saudi Arabia. Premiums vary depending on your age, riding experience, and the level of coverage.
    • Registration Fees: You'll need to pay annual registration fees to keep your bike legal.
    • Maintenance: Regular maintenance, such as oil changes, filter replacements, and tune-ups, is essential to keep your RC 390 running smoothly.
    • Fuel: The RC 390 is relatively fuel-efficient, but fuel costs can add up over time, especially if you ride frequently.
    • Tires: Tires wear out and need to be replaced periodically. High-performance tires can be expensive.
    • Gear: Investing in quality riding gear, such as a helmet, jacket, gloves, and boots, is crucial for your safety. While it's an upfront cost, it's an investment in your well-being.
